cd- changes the directoy . cd acommand also supports'.', '..', '-', '~'. works on bothrelativeandabsolute path -
pwd- prints thecurrent working directory -
echo- prints the strings as it is after handling tabs and spaces -
ls- lists all the information of a file or files inside a directory also suppports -a (prints hidden files) flag and -l (prints information in long format) flag -
exit or quit- these commands will kill the terminal
-
background- commands ending with '&' are treated as background processes. After exiting the process name along with the pid is printed with status normally or abnormally. -
foreground- all other commands are treated as foreground commands. The time interval for which the command executes is also printed.
